Which expression is equivalent to (2^3)^-5

You didn't list the options, but I think I know the answer. Let me know if my answer isn't listed! :)

[tex] (x^{3} )^{-5} [/tex]
We need to multiply the exponents.
3 · -5 = -15

The answer is [tex] 2^{-15} [/tex]
